Background
Continuing the discussion from the price and booking information, let’s explore the background of the Udawalawe National Park Safari.
Conservation Implications:
Udawalawe National Park was established in 1972 as a sanctuary for wildlife, particularly the large population of elephants that reside in the area. The park plays a crucial role in preserving the natural habitat and biodiversity of Sri Lanka.Environmental Challenges:
The park faces various challenges, including encroachment by nearby communities, habitat degradation, and human-wildlife conflict. Efforts are being made to address these issues through community-based conservation initiatives and sustainable tourism practices.Safari Experience:
The Udawalawe National Park Safari offers visitors a unique opportunity to observe and appreciate the diverse wildlife that inhabits the park. From majestic elephants to elusive leopards, the safari promises an unforgettable adventure in a breathtaking natural setting.
Directions
To reach Udawalawe National Park for your safari adventure, follow these directions.
If you prefer public transportation, you can take a bus from Colombo to Embilipitiya, which is approximately 134 kilometers away from the park. From Embilipitiya, you can then take a tuk-tuk or a taxi to reach Udawalawe National Park.
Alternatively, if you prefer a more scenic route, you can take the A8 highway from Colombo to Ratnapura and then proceed to Udawalawe National Park via Pelmadulla. This route will take you through beautiful landscapes and is a great option for those who enjoy road trips.
Whichever route you choose, you’ll eventually arrive at Udawalawe National Park ready to embark on your thrilling safari adventure.
